Brisbane’s cocktail scene is getting a shake-up. In an Australian first, the expert mixologists at Barcelona bar Paradiso have partnered with W Brisbane to bring their epic cosmic-inspired Universo cocktail menu to Living Room Bar from 12 May. The award-winning bar, which came in as #3 on the World’s 50 Best Bars last year, is world-renowned for their theatrical cocktail creations that enchant in both taste and appearance.
Paradiso was born in the Catalan capital’s trendy El Born neighborhood of Barcelona – a speakeasy hidden behind a fridge door inside an unassuming pastrami shop. Led by famed mixologist Giacomo Giannotti, Paradiso was the culmination of all he had learned in his craft.
Having started the art of mixing flavours in his family-owned ice-cream parlour at a young age, Giacomo couldn’t resist but have a nod to Gelateria Paradiso, where it all started, in the name of his own personal project. His dedication to his craft over his 30-year career earned Giacomo accolades including Best Barman of Spain 2017, and Best Italian Bartender Abroad 2019, while Paradiso featured among the world heavy-hitters on in the Worlds Best Menu on Tales of the Cocktail Spirited Awards 2020, and Best Cocktail Menu in Spain in the International Cocktail Bar Fair 2021.
The collab with W Brisbane will see ten show-stopping cocktails from Paradiso’s signature classics and famed Universo menu brought to life at Living Room Bar. Fascinated by the unknown, in creating the Universo menu Giacomo drew on the vast cosmos as the inspiration for an intricate array of creations that surprise the senses – be it in taste, aroma or presentation. Unique and little-known ingredients from baobab to cola nut, pandan leaves and electric liqueur, all bring an element of discovering the unknown. Paired with elaborate theatrics like dry ice, smoke, light and innovative glassware, each drink is presented as an experience in itself.
Signature cocktail Mediterranean Treasure, which was awarded the best cocktail in Spain in 2014, blends sour and savoury flavours of land and sea – inspired by Giacomo’s adopted hometown of Barcelona. Flavours of elderflower, honey, citrus fruits, and coriander are balanced by the tang of oyster leaf infused in Fino sherry. For an all-time maritime experience, the cocktail comes served in a treasure chest, emitting a delicate smoke as the treasure box is opened.
Paradiso’s take on the Old-Fashioned, the Great Gatsby comes served in a glass dome emitting a chocolate and vanilla tobacco cloud as it is lifted, revealing a refined take on the classic featuring Glendronach Port Wood, Amaro, White Truffle Honey and Lavender Bitters.
From the Universo menu, The Cloud makes sense of the greatness of the sky through science, developed in a lab incorporating mixology trends of the future like non-gravital food and acoustic levitation. Experimenting with different shapes and textures, Paradiso set out to create a cocktail that comes served with an edible coffee cloud, a technique exclusive to Paradiso. The flavours of the drink are finessed with Amor de Maguey Mezcal, Herradura Añejo Tequila, Amaro Montenegro, Mandenii La Tonique Vermouth, Hibiscus and Birch Syrup.
Perfect to share, The Big Bang is made with an unusual blend of Milton spiced cane rum, guava liqueur, Earl Grey tea, pandan, beetroot, clarified lemon juice and almond milk, served on a platter of sweet delights that mimic the creation of the universe and the spreading of celestial matter.
